Install from debian repository results in 'Error: Invalid icon path'

DEBUG:gpu-utils:env.set_args:Install type: debian
DEBUG:gpu-utils:env.set_args:Command line arguments:
  Namespace(about=False, short=False, table=False, pstates=False, ppm=False, clinfo=False, no_fan=False, debug=True)
DEBUG:gpu-utils:env.set_args:Local TZ: PDT
DEBUG:gpu-utils:env.set_args:pciid path set to: /usr/share/misc/pci.ids
DEBUG:gpu-utils:env.set_args:Icon path set to: None
DEBUG:gpu-utils:gpu-ls.main:########## gpu-ls 3.6.0
DEBUG:gpu-utils:env.check_env:Using python: 3.10.4
DEBUG:gpu-utils:env.check_env:Using Linux Kernel: 5.15.0-25-generic
DEBUG:gpu-utils:env.check_env:Using Linux Distro: Ubuntu
DEBUG:gpu-utils:env.check_env:Linux Distro Description: Ubuntu 22.04 LTS
DEBUG:gpu-utils:env.check_env:Distro: Ubuntu, Ubuntu 22.04 LTS

setup.py treats both icons and man pages as data files. The man files get installed properly, but rickslab-gpu-utils is not created in /usr/share.
